Acting
From
your very first semester, you can become part of the Coe College theatre
experience onstage. Auditions are open to the entire campus community
and you are welcome to participate, regardless of your declared or intended
major. We mount three mainstage productions each year, and additional
independent student-directed projects are always encouraged. Practicum
credit is available for production involvement.
The Coe College Department of Theatre and Drama is proud to be offering seven different classes that focus on the art of acting:
Acting I
Acting II
Advanced Acting: Shakespeare
Acting for the Camera
Musical Theatre Acting
Movement for the Stage
Voice and Diction
With these seven classes we give our students as thorough an overview as possible of the skills that will be demanded of them if they undertake an acting career. Their chances, however, of working in professional theatre will be greatly enhanced if they continue their training in a conservatory setting following their years at Coe. For this reason, much of our focus, particularly in the upper level courses, is aimed at preparing them for that experience.
